The ocean current flowing along the west coast of a continent in the midlatitudes tends to be cooler compared to ocean currents along the east coast due to upwelling of colder water from deeper layers. This phenomenon brings nutrient-rich water to the surface, supporting diverse marine ecosystems. Examples include the California Current off the west coast of North America, which contributes to the cooler temperatures in that region.
The cool temperature along the West Coast is largely due to the cold ocean currents that flow southwards along the coast. Additionally, the marine layer, a thick fog that forms from the interaction of cold ocean water and warm air, also contributes to the cooler climate in this region. The prevailing westerly winds off the Pacific Ocean bring cooler air onto the coast, further lowering temperatures.
